Just about every race/event I have done in the WINWAR Racing Golf, the exhaust has given me problems. The car came with a very nice Techtonics cat back. I think the problem is that it goes over the rear beam and when really hammering on it in the turns...for hours on end, the beam pushes up on it and eventually the hangers let go and then I'm flagged for dragging the damn things around the track.
I really dont want to have to replace the entire thing as its very nice, mandrel bent and all. I was thinking of just creating "locks" for the hangers so that they can not fall off if/when the pressure is taken off of them.
I was also thinking that maybe I should just go with a cherry bomb mounted down the exhaust tunnel and have the exhaust come out in front of the rear wheel. Is that a huge no-no. I would imagine that it may heat the tire and might be REALLY annoying as it would have to come out on the drivers side. Pass side has the fuel pump and filter there.
Does anyone have any idea if a 1.8 8v Golf would be too loud with just a single cherry bomb?
